40khz Piezoelectric Ultrasonic Spot Welding Transducer For Ultrasonic Plastic Welding Machine

The principle of Ultrasonic welding transducer is similar to that of cleaning the transducer. It also applies prestress to offset the expansion stress of piezoelectric ceramics to achieve high frequency vibration with large amplitude. Due to the high instantaneous power required for welding transducers, they have high requirements for materials and processes, and are classified as high-power acoustic energy transducers. Usually, a high-power and large-amplitude vibration system is composed of a horn and a working head to complete ultrasonic welding of materials such as plastic and metal.

Ultrasonic welding is to generate high-frequency friction and heat on the contact gap surface of the welded object under pressure through the ultrasonic vibration generated by the transducer, so as to achieve the purpose of thermal fusion welding.

The Ultrasonic welding transducer is a high-power transducer working in gaps or pulses, and its power is generally calculated by the instantaneous peak power.

Product installation matters

Precautions for installing transducers from our company:

  1. Select appropriate materials and adjust the hardness process to process and produce the variable amplitude pole and working head.
  2. When installing the amplitude converter or working head, it is necessary to pay attention to frequency matching and apply sound conductive adhesive at the joint.
  3. Use solvents such as acetone to clean the joined surface during installation
  4. Establish an impedance control process for the bonding process to reduce the bonding impedance of the oscillator and improve its electro-acoustic conversion efficiency.
  5. Pay attention to improving the insulation measures of the oscillator electrode after installation.
